Studio Manager (9-Month Fixed Term Contract, with Possible Extension)

Find out if this opportunity is a good fit by reading all of the information that follows below.

Alconbury Weald, Huntingdon, PE28 4YA

Monday – Friday, 8am – 5pm

About Us

At MM Flowers, we’re passionate about delivering beautiful, high-quality flowers to our customers every day. Our team is dynamic, innovative, and committed to excellence in everything we do. We’re now looking for a Studio Manager to join our New Product Development (NPD) team on a 9-month fixed term contract (with the possibility of extension), leading the seamless running of our sample production studio.

The Role

As Studio Manager, you’ll play a key role in overseeing the full sample lifecycle – from raw material procurement to final delivery. You’ll manage a small team, ensuring all samples meet the highest standards of quality and are delivered on time. Working closely with NPD managers, procurement, and wider teams, you’ll keep operations efficient, organised, and aligned with customer needs.

Key Responsibilities

  • Oversee day-to-day studio operations, ensuring smooth sample creation and dispatch.
  • Lead, coach, and develop the studio team to achieve high performance.
  • Forecast and manage stock, materials, and equipment with minimal wastage.
  • Conduct quality assurance checks and ensure samples meet specifications.
  • Work cross-functionally to align studio processes with project goals.
  • Maintain accurate records and ensure compliance with good manufacturing practices.

About You

We’re looking for someone who is organised, proactive, and thrives in a fast-paced environment. You’ll have:

  • Proven experience managing operations or production, ideally within floristry, FMCG, or a creative/design environment.
  • Strong leadership and team management skills.
  • Excellent planning, organisation, and communication skills.
  • Experience with stock management systems (Rubicon experience desirable).
  • A keen eye for quality and detail.

What We Offer

  • 9-month fixed term contract, with possible extension.
  • Full-time hours: 40 per week (Monday – Friday, 8am–5pm).
  • Competitive salary (discussed at interview).
  • 25 days holiday plus bank holidays (pro rata).
  • Company pension scheme.
  • Life assurance cover.
  • Free onsite parking.
  • Employee Assistance Programme.
  • Staff discount scheme.
  • Opportunities to grow and develop within a fast-paced, innovative business.
  • A friendly, supportive team environment where your ideas make an impact.
